show diag gives some serial numbers, but it's not supported under all IOS's
(11.3 and higher, maybe?).

Here's some sample output from a 3660 (Running 12.0(something))

xxxxxxx3660-1#show diag

3660 Chassis type: ENTERPRISE

c3600 Backplane EEPROM:
        Hardware Revision        : 1.0
        Part Number              : 800-04740-02
        Board Revision           : C0
        Deviation Number         : 0-0
        Fab Version              : 02
        PCB Serial Number        : HAD042110PH
        RMA Test History         : 00
        RMA Number               : 0-0-0-0
        RMA History              : 00
        Chassis Serial Number    : JAB04238694
        Chassis MAC Address      : 0002.4b7c.f590
        MAC Address block size   : 112
        Manufacturing Test Data  : 00 00 00 00 00 00 00 00
        Fab Part Number          : 28-2651-02
        Number of Slots          : 6
        EEPROM format version 4

<<snip>>

It also shows serial numbers for the modules present.  (Not shown for
brevity).
